I tried to explain why Lance fits better than Fields and Jones for months but got serious backlash from it.

It was all about Lance's feet, the ability to sell the play fake, quick decision making, and his off the charts mental ability to recall his offense which was far closer to Kyle's scheme than any other QB.

I still think Fields will be a very good QB and Jones as well for that matter. But there's no doubt in my mind we made the right selection.

Agreed. Overall, I'm very excited to see how Trey Lance's career unfolds, especially in comparison to his contemporaries. As a fan of football in general, this will be an interesting case study on finding a QB and developing him. It should give a lot of evidence for questions like:

--- How important is it that a player is given time to develop?
--- How important is it that a rookie has a good surrounding cast around him?
--- How important is the ability to improvise on off-schedule plays?
--- How does a lack of film due to the 2020 pandemic effect player evaluation?

Because when you look at this draft, you have five QB's in very different situations.
  • Trevor Lawrence and Zach Wilson are probably the most polished, well-rounded, but they're going to very bad teams.
  • Mac Jones is a high floor, low ceiling pocket passer, but he's going to a well-established team and coaching staff.
  • Justin Fields and Trey Lance aren't considered to be as good in the pocket, but are superlative athletes and are both said to be extremely intelligent. Fields comes from a big school. Lance comes from a small school that run a pro offense.

Fields is not that good. Both Carolina and Denver passed on him when they had the chance. Lance is the coveted one. He would've gone 4th to the Falcons. We realized that was the case and had to move up to 3.
The situation had changed out of necessity. At the time the trade was made, both were looking for a QB. I suspect Carolina realized the top 4 would be gone by their pick and settled for Darnold. Denver decided the draft capital was better spent elsewhere thereby giving Lock another year to develop. Had those decisions not been made, it is highly unlikely Fields would have dropped past them.

If you tell me that this doesn't remind you of Kaepernick then you lying.


They're both big, tall, athletic passers that are explosive running the ball in the open field. Both got passed over by bigger schools that wanted them to play safety. Kaepernick played for the 49ers recently, so that's going to be people's main frame of reference for a tall, big armed, athletic passer.

Beyond that, if anything, Lance is probably a lot more similar to Josh Allen as a passer. He's already more advanced than Kaepernick was coming out of Nevada.
